About this cigar
La Aurora has been crafting tobacco since 1903, and their Nicaragua line represents a modern expression of Dominican tradition. The 107 Nicaragua delivers an accessible medium body wrapped in a sun-grown Ecuadorian Habano that brings earthy depth and subtle spice without overwhelming newer enthusiasts or demanding an experienced palate. This Belicoso cuts a distinguished profile on the shelf, its tapered head catching light in ways that box-pressed torpedos cannot. The smoking experience opens with black pepper and cedar, settling into notes of cocoa and toasted almond as the cigar develops. It's the kind of stick that rewards a measured pace, its consistent draw and even burn making it reliable for your customers from first light to the nub. The 107 Nicaragua works equally well as an after-dinner smoke or during a leisure afternoon, hitting a sweet spot between boldness and approachability that keeps repeat buyers coming back.
